)]}'
{
  "commit": "49258610ebd4cec764c2d01e8fdf713b7067c96a",
  "tree": "7571215cc452fa492d6c4d9db4628f54726e3ce3",
  "parents": [
    "74d09d47dbb0b3c1fbdaf3a052bb02148f24300c"
  ],
  "author": {
    "name": "Nico Huber",
    "email": "nico.h@gmx.de",
    "time": "Sat Jun 15 21:41:21 2019 +0200"
  },
  "committer": {
    "name": "Nico Huber",
    "email": "nico.h@gmx.de",
    "time": "Sun Jan 29 12:29:02 2023 +0000"
  },
  "message": "layout: Use linked list for `struct romentry`\n\nThis gets rid of the entry limit and hopefully makes future layout\nhandling easier. We start by making `struct flashrom_layout` private\nto `layout.c`.\n\nChange-Id: I60a0aa1007ebcd5eb401db116f835d129b3e9732\nSigned-off-by: Nico Huber \u003cnico.h@gmx.de\u003e\nOriginal-Reviewed-on: https://review.coreboot.org/c/flashrom/+/33521\nOriginal-Reviewed-by: Edward O\u0027Callaghan \u003cquasisec@chromium.org\u003e\nOriginal-Reviewed-by: Angel Pons \u003cth3fanbus@gmail.com\u003e\nReviewed-on: https://review.coreboot.org/c/flashrom-stable/+/72217\nTested-by: build bot (Jenkins) \u003cno-reply@coreboot.org\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"36fa0b6d68db73a11a81b2cca9e16fd2a66e0f9d",
      "old_mode": 33188,
      "old_path": "layout.c",
      "new_id": "917853eb87fbecdb6f32c87aaf48172ab9d65b53",
      "new_mode": 33188,
      "new_path": "layout.c"
    },
    {
      "type": "modify",
      "old_id": "6bd3732b6f4a6a477495adda22128ce189b48dea",
      "old_mode": 33188,
      "old_path": "layout.h",
      "new_id": "7fb90380ab2d4b5383656d622fe6da7bfc54a58f",
      "new_mode": 33188,
      "new_path": "layout.h"
    },
    {
      "type": "modify",
      "old_id": "9b5d8756b981d4dc8359ae1ea9eb31b722910d55",
      "old_mode": 33188,
      "old_path": "libflashrom.c",
      "new_id": "682abe3643dd0e9a9cf425566a241cad8c9a16ac",
      "new_mode": 33188,
      "new_path": "libflashrom.c"
    }
  ]
}
